The aloe polysaccharide extraction technology was studied, response surface method optimization of four factors and three levels was processed by the Design-Expert software based on five single factor tests. And a high fitting degree, small experiment error and good repeatability mathematical model was established. Results showed that the optimum technique of ultrasonic-assisted extraction of polysaccharide from gel of Aloe barbadensis Miller was as follows:ultrasonic power was600W, ultrasonic time was45min, temperature was70℃, liquid-material ratio was5:1, pH was8.9and extraction time was once. In this condition, the percentage of extraction was0.1511%, which differed insignificantly with the predictive value.2. The deproteinization technology of polysaccharide from gel of Aloe barbadensis Miller was studied, the deproteinization rate of protein and the retention rate of polysaccharide were as comprehensive evaluation index, deproteinization effect of five methods including TCA, Sevag, papain, papain-TCA, papain-Sevag on polysaccharide were compared. Results showed that papain-TCA method was the optimum deproteinization technology and its operation was as follows:the amount of papain was2%, enzymatic time was1h, temperature was60℃, pH was6and followed by one treatment with5%TCA. Under this condition, the rate of deproteinization was83.4%, and the retention of polysaccharide was74.9%. The polysaccharide’s structure was analyzed by IR spectrum, UV spectrum,1H-NMR spectra and TG, comparison results showed that the characteristics of aloe polysaccharide were retained and some characteristic peak were reinforced to be easier to identify, the characteristic peaks of other impurities were eliminated or significantly weakened.3. The accelerated solvent extraction (ASE) technique of aloin from skin of Aloe barbadensis Miller was studied, optimization of four factors and three levels was processed based on three single factor tests. Results showed that the optimum technique of accelerated solvent extraction of aloin was as follows:extraction time was5min, extraction temperature was50℃, ethanol concentration was80%and extraction time was once. In this condition, the rate of extraction was1.91%. And the HPLC methodology was studied to determine its content.4. A kind of traditional Chinese medical compound health food granule was prepared by mixing aloe extract, Haematococcus Pluvialis. powder, Amomum villosum Lour, powder, Morinda citrifolia Linn, juice and other pharmaceutical excipients. Its quality standard was established, introducing the produce method, its traits and name, etc. TLC identification method was established by testing aloin, astaxanthin, bornyl acetate and scopoletin by refering to the2010version of "Chinese Pharmacopoeia". It was regulated that the granularity, moisture, ash content must not exceed15.0%,15.0%and7.0%respectively, and heavy metal such as lead, total arsenic and total mercury content must not exceed2.0mg/kg,1.0mg/kg and0.3mg/kg respectively. The content of functional components such as aloin, O-acetyl, astaxanthin, bornyl acetate and scopoletin shall be not less than4.00mg/g,3.90mg/g,1.20mg/g,2.40mg/g and170μg/g, and their methodology was studied, based on the pharmacopoeia and related standards.Finally, according to the ability of removing DPPH free radica and reducing power, the compound health care food preliminary showed a certain extent of antioxidant activity in vitro. |
